Nathaniel Dett, Carl Diton, Ballanta Taylor, Edward Boatner, Hall Johnson, Lawrence Brown and others are the young negro musicians who while doing impressive solo settings are also returning bit by bit to the choral performing. Musically speaking, only the obvious resources in this sphere have been touched upon till now. Just as soon as the traditional covenant of four-part harmonic organization and the oratorio style and form are not followed any more, we may expect the development of the Negro folk music to the extend equal or even outrunning the astounding Russian choral music. With its harmonic inconstancy and interchangeable voice parts, Negro folk songs only conventionally belong to the four-part style. Being skipped measured and interpolated they turn to be the least potentially polyphonic. It can be carried out without snapping its own boundaries. Tangled and unique development in modernistic music is awaited in future. What is really interesting is why something brand new has not been contributed by Negro folk music to contemporary choral and orchestral musical yet
In addition to all said above, let us innumerate the folk song origins of the very tradition that is already classic in Europe now. Up to nowadays, the Negro music resources have been utilized in only one direction at a time: rhythmically here, melodically there, harmonically -somewhere else. The one who would organize its distinctive features in a formal subdivision would be the musical genius of his time.
